WebApr 8, 2010 · This is all you need to add a hosts file entry: Add-Content -Path $env:windir\System32\drivers\etc\hosts -Value "`n127.0.0.1`tlocalhost" -Force IP address and hostname are separated by `t which is the PowerShell notation for a tab character. `n is the PowerShell notation for a newline. Share Improve this answer Follow edited Mar 26, … WebMay 17, 2011 · In Windows PowerShell, the host is what you, as a user, interact with. You will typically interact with the two default hosts: the Windows PowerShell console and the Windows PowerShell Integrated Scripting Environment (ISE). When you use Write-Host, you are telling Windows PowerShell to simply display something in the host to the user.

WebA collection of code or statements that are enclosed with in a {} is known as a scriptblock. It can also be considered as an expression. This makes it easier for the developers to segment the code into various divisions and the same code can be used in various places with ease. It is like a function, but scriptblock doesn’t have a name.
